This research is a development research (R&D) using the Rowntree model, which aims to produce digital safety e-modules for digital literacy study program students of FIP UNM. Educational Technology Study Program. The research method used is the research and development method using the Rowntree model. Data collection techniques include questionnaires, observations, assessment questionnaires, and documentation. Data analysis techniques used qualitative descriptive analysis techniques and quantitative descriptive analysis. The results of expert validation show that the Digital Safety e-Module that has been developed has obtained valid criteria with a percentage of 100% in the content aspect, a rate of 100% in the language aspect, and a percentage of 98% in the media design aspect. The practicality test of the product is seen from the average score of the questionnaire at the one-to-one evaluation stage and the field trial stage. The average assessment score was 95% at the one-to-one evaluation stage, with a very practical category. The average assessment score at the field trial stage was 92.5%, with a very practical category. Thus, the Digital Safety e-Module product for Digital Literacy Study Program Students, Department of Educational Technology FIP UNM, has been developed with validity and practicality.
